Luciano Pavarotti's first wife has not gotten over the divorce

Pavarotti's first wife, Adua Veroni, did not attend the funeral chapel installed by the tenor but did attend the funeral held last Saturday in Modena. And in 1996 they separated and later the singer married Nicoletta Mantovani. With Adua he had three daughters and with Nicoletta twins, of which only the girl survived. In any case, the first wife did not come out badly from the divorce since it is said that she received 100 million euros. And Pavarotti was immensely rich, as befits an artist who alone sold one hundred million records.

Adua was born in Rome in 1937. In 1965 she married the tenor, with whom she had three daughters Lorenza, Cristina and Juliana. Wife, mother and manager of the singer, she maintained a parallel sentimental and professional career with him that was cut short by the divorce and in which, as was seen on Saturday, the distances and disagreements have not been easy to overcome.

Nicoletta was Pavarotti's secretary. In 1995, photos surfaced of the two kissing in Barbados. The wife, Adua, claimed it was just a “flirt.” But later Pavarotti confessed that he felt lost without his secretary, lost not professionally but personally. “She's my ray of sunshine,” he said. They were in love.

Verdi's “Ave Maria” echoed through Modena Cathedral on Saturday as thousands of people bid farewell to Luciano Pavarotti at a funeral attended by members of his family, dignitaries and friends, and watched by his admirers around the world.

The tenor received a tremendous final ovation after being broadcast a recording of the great Italian tenor singing a duet with his father “Panis angelicus”, which they performed in 1978 in the same cathedral. Archbishop Benito Cocchi mentioned this fact in his homily after it was told to him by a witness, who described it as “two tenors interweaving,” taking turns to continue the melody.
